Galaxy Note7 is a bit better than Xiaomi Poco M3, with a 79.5 score against 78.2. Galaxy Note7's design is lighter and somewhat thinner than Xiaomi Poco M3, even though it was released 4 years before. The Xiaomi Poco M3 features a little faster CPU than Galaxy Note7, and although they both have the same RAM amount, the Xiaomi Poco M3 also has 4 more CPU cores.
Samsung Galaxy Note7 features a little more vivid display than Xiaomi Poco M3, because although it has a quite smaller display, it also counts with a better resolution of 1440 x 2560 and a higher pixels quantity per inch of screen. Xiaomi Poco M3 shoots much better videos and photos than Galaxy Note7, because although it has a tinier diafragm aperture which is not good for shooting photos or video in poorly lited situations, and they both have the same video frame rate and the same video definition, the Xiaomi Poco M3 also counts with a camera with much more mega pixels and a bigger sensor capturing better quality videos and photographs.
The Xiaomi Poco M3 counts with a little bit more storage capacity for apps and games than Galaxy Note7, and although they both have exactly the same internal storage, the Xiaomi Poco M3 also has a SD card slot that holds up to 512 GB. The Xiaomi Poco M3 counts with a much longer battery duration than Galaxy Note7, because it has 6000mAh of battery capacity.
